What is Necessary to Get Prepared for Phlebotomist Training in Lafayette IN

Even though there aren’t many steps required in training to become a Phlebotomy Technician, you need to pay attention to the ones that exist. You need to be of minimum age to work in Indiana, hold a high school degree or equivalent, successfully pass a criminal record screening, and also have a clean screening for illicit drugs.
